Understanding the Crash Game Mechanics
Crash games are fundamentally simple yet incredibly engaging. A multiplier starts at 1x and steadily increases over time. Players place bets at the beginning of each round, and the goal is to cash out before the multiplier “crashes,” returning to zero. The longer you wait, the higher the potential payout, but the greater the risk of losing your entire stake. The appeal lies in the adrenaline rush of trying to maximize winnings against the odds. Live Bets, displaying the stakes and wins of other players in real-time, contribute a social aspect, fostering friendly competition and observable, albeit limited, data points.
| Rising Multiplier | The core mechanic, increasing with each passing moment. |
| Crash Point | A random point at which the multiplier resets to zero. |
| Cash Out | The action of claiming winnings before the crash occurs. |
| Live Bets | Real-time display of other players’ bets and earnings. |
The Role of Provably Fair Technology
One of the most crucial aspects of reputable crash games is the implementation of “Provably Fair” technology. This system allows players to verify the fairness of each round using cryptographic algorithms. Rather than relying on the casino’s word, players can independently confirm that the outcome wasn’t manipulated. This is achieved by utilizing server seeds (generated by the casino) and client seeds (generated by the player) to determine the game’s outcome. The combination of these seeds, through a hash function, generates a result that is demonstrably random and verifiable by anyone with the technical knowledge to do so. This transparency builds trust and ensures a level playing field for all participants.
The framework ensures that neither the user nor the operator can influence the result after the client seed has been revealed. The Limitations of Prediction in Random Systems
The fundamental principle behind crash games lies in its reliance on a Random Number Generator (RNG). A well-implemented RNG should produce outcomes that are statistically independent of one another, meaning that past results have no bearing on future results. Attempting to predict the crash point based on previous data is akin to trying to predict the outcome of a coin flip based on the results of previous flips. While it’s statistically possible, the probability of success is minimal. Understanding and Mitigating the Gambler’s Fallacy
A common cognitive bias that affects many gamblers is the “Gambler’s Fallacy”—the mistaken belief that past events influence future independent events. For instance, if the crash has not occurred for several consecutive rounds, players might believe that a crash is “due” to happen, leading them to increase their bets. However, each round of a crash game is independent, and the probability of a crash remains the same regardless of previous outcomes. Being aware of this bias is essential in making rational betting decisions.
Another aspect to consider is the “near miss” effect, where players feel more compelled to continue betting after narrowly avoiding a crash. This can lead to chasing losses and exceeding predetermined budget limits. A disciplined approach involves acknowledging that near misses are a natural part of the game and avoiding emotional reactions. Remaining objective and focusing on long-term risk management will guide better decision-making.
